Floating Deck Installation in Redmond, WA

Floating deck installation services involve constructing a sturdy, elevated platform that rests directly on the ground or a prepared surface, rather than being attached to the main structure of the home. These decks are popular for creating outdoor living spaces in yards, gardens, or other open areas, and they can be customized to fit various sizes and styles. Projects typically include leveling the ground, preparing the base, and building a deck that provides a stable surface for furniture, grills, or outdoor activities, making them suitable for both small patios and larger backyard retreats.

Homeowners interested in floating deck installation usually want to understand the materials used, the design options available, and how the project will integrate with their existing landscape. It’s important to consider factors such as weather resistance, maintenance requirements, and the overall aesthetic of the outdoor space. Clarifying these details beforehand can help property owners make informed decisions about size, placement, and features to ensure the completed deck meets their outdoor living needs.

Floating Deck Installation Questions

What is a floating deck? A floating deck is a free-standing platform that rests directly on the ground or a prepared base, not attached to the house or other structures.

What are common uses for floating decks? They are often used for outdoor seating, dining areas, or to create level spaces in uneven yards.

What should property owners consider before installation? It's important to evaluate the ground condition, drainage, and the intended use to ensure proper support and stability.

How does a floating deck differ from a traditional deck? Unlike traditional decks that are attached to a building, floating decks are independent structures that do not require anchoring to the house.
